Quandela is a European leader in photonic quantum computing. We deliver high-performance quantum processors—on-premise or through cloud access—enabling organizations to explore quantum advantage in optimization, simulation, and machine learning. As we scale to meet rapidly growing market demand, we are expanding our Sales Engineering organization to help enterprise, HPC centers, and research institutions adopt quantum technologies seamlessly.
As an HPC Senior Technical Presales Engineer at Quandela, you will serve as the technical bridge between our sales team and prospective customers. You will analyze complex HPC environments, evaluate workloads, and design tailored quantum system configurations that integrate smoothly with existing infrastructures. Your mission is to help organizations understand how quantum computing fits within their HPC strategy, demonstrate the technical value of Quandela’s photonic quantum platforms, and ensure strong technical qualification during the sales cycle.
